我正在尝试为PEG.js编写一个简单的语法,它将匹配下面这样的内容:arbitrary other text that can also have µnicode; differentsemicolon"问题是,如果我在输入中放入分号以外的任何内容,我会得到:
SyntaxError: Expected ";", "\\;" or any character but end of input我读到过PEG.js无法匹配输入末尾。
我正在使用带有typescript的vue.js来拥有一个输入字段,用户可以从下拉菜单中选择项目,也可以实际输入一些自定义输入。有不同的用例:允许自定义输入或仅从下拉菜单输入(这是硬编码的)。我发现,我可以使用" use - input“来激活或取消激活键盘上的用户输入。不幸的是,到目前为止,我只能通过在<q-select></q-select>中使用"use-input“或者完全删除它来控制这种行为。相反,我希望能够通过一些标志来控制输入行为,例如use-input=